As far as hometime with TransAm, plan to be flexible. Often times I had to stay out extra days to a week because the days I had originally requested were denied due to too many drivers being off the same time. I always put my new hometime request in when I got back on the truck after just finishing hometime. That way you know whether you will be going home when you want right away. Keep in mind, that for the major holidays you will need to put in months in advance. And once you do, you cannot get another hometime. You have to work all those weeks to the holiday consecutively as you can only have ONE SCHEDULED HOMETIME AT A TIME. TA employs 50 percent of their drivers for Thanksgiving, Christmas. Not sure about New Years. I think I worked all the majors except for New Years in my 54 weeks there. Fact of trucking life. Consider yourself forewarned.
